Transaction 8239a23cfc760d05222668b97b9b1fe94ba36201a88ec03623c5d73d8a60fb22
1 Input
1 Output
-
8239a23cfc760d05222668b97b9b1fe94ba36201a88ec03623c5d73d8a60fb22:0
- value
- 1902780
- script pubkey
- OP_0 OP_PUSHBYTES_20 1595bbf4deece21451055eb184ec466df9271a89
- address
- bc1qzk2mhax7an3pg5g9t6ccfmzxdhujwx5fkyqsmy